    Drs. May and Tim Hindmarsh catch up with civil rights attorney Ryan Heath, who has been a leading advocate in cases centered around free speech, parental rights, and medical freedoms. Heath shares updates on his current legal battles, including lawsuits in California and Arizona, where he is fighting for the rights of individuals affected by COVID-19 restrictions, unfair educational policies, and free speech violations. Heath also dives deep into how these cases could set significant legal precedents.

    BS Free MD hosts an explosive conversation with Sharyl Attkisson, who shares insights from her extensive career in investigative journalism. They discuss the disturbing influence Big Pharma exerts over media outlets and the medical community, highlighting cases where essential truths were censored or misrepresented. Attkisson draws on personal experiences and research for her latest book, Follow the Science, to reveal just how deeply the pharmaceutical industry has embedded itself in newsrooms, government policy, and even medical education. Both hosts and Attkisson agree that real change requires questioning narratives and refusing to be silenced.

    Sharyl Attkisson is a renowned investigative journalist with over three decades of experience at major news networks, including CBS News, PBS, and CNN. She has earned five Emmy Awards and the Edward R. Murrow Award for her groundbreaking reporting. Known for her fearless pursuit of the truth, Attkisson has exposed corruption in medicine, politics, and beyond. Her bestselling books, Stonewalled, The Smear, and Slanted, uncover the layers of media manipulation and political spin. In her latest work, Follow the Science, she tackles the powerful pharmaceutical industry’s influence on media and public health. Attkisson is also the host of Full Measure, a Sunday TV show dedicated to investigative journalism.
